Debian系統使用lsnrctl命令來進行Oracle數據庫的監聽服務控制。為了確保系統的穩定性和安全性,定期更新和維護lsnrctl是非常重要的。以下是一些更新和維護lsnrctl的技巧:
更新系統包: 在進行任何操作之前,確保系統是最新的。使用以下命令更新系統:
sudo apt update
sudo apt upgrade -y
sudo apt dist-upgrade -y
sudo apt autoclean
sudo apt autoremove -y
檢查Oracle客戶端版本:
確保Oracle客戶端與lsnrctl版本兼容??梢酝ㄟ^以下命令檢查Oracle客戶端版本:
lsnrctl version
定期檢查監聽狀態:
使用lsnrctl status命令定期檢查監聽狀態,確保所有服務正常運行。
sudo lsnrctl status
日志分析:
定期檢查Oracle監聽日志,通常位于/var/log/oracle/lsnr/lsnrctl.log,以便及時發現和解決問題。
備份配置文件:
在進行任何更改之前,備份所有相關的配置文件,例如listener.ora和tnsnames.ora。
使用腳本自動化: 可以編寫腳本定期執行上述任務,例如檢查監聽狀態和更新系統。
以上是Debian系統上lsnrctl的更新和維護技巧。